Technical Specifications and Material Composition

The foundation of a reliable stadium chair lies in its material composition and structural design. Based on observed product data, the primary material for high-durability units is steel, specifically Q235B Carbon Steel for bleacher structures. This material choice is critical for supporting the dynamic loads associated with public gatherings. The frame construction often utilizes steel tubes, which are subjected to powder coating to prevent corrosion and ensure longevity in both indoor and outdoor environments.

In contrast, other variants in the market utilize Polypropylene (PP) or general plastic for the seating surface. While these materials offer cost advantages and resistance to moisture, they may lack the structural rigidity required for heavy-duty stadium applications. Compliance and Certification Verification

In the B2B procurement of public seating, certification is not merely a marketing claim but a legal and safety prerequisite. The supply chain for foldable steel chairs often includes products certified under ISO9001:2008 for quality management and ISO14001:2004 for environmental management. Additionally, international market access often requires CE marking, along with verification from third-party testing agencies like SGS and TUV. These certifications provide evidence that the manufacturing process adheres to recognized standards, though the specific version of the standard (e.g., 2008 vs. newer iterations) should be confirmed in the supplier's documentation.

For structural components, the use of Q235B Carbon Steel is a specific material standard that buyers should request to see in mill test reports. This ensures the steel meets the necessary yield strength and tensile properties for safety. Furthermore, the surface treatment process, typically powder coating, must be verified to ensure it provides adequate protection against rust, especially for chairs designated for "Outdoor" or "Beach Chair" applications. The "Product Standard" attribute often lists "as per product," which is a vague descriptor. Buyers must explicitly request the specific engineering standards or local building codes that the chair design complies with, rather than accepting generic statements.

Cost Drivers and Pricing Dynamics

The pricing of foldable steel stadium chairs is influenced by a complex interplay of material costs, manufacturing complexity, and order volume. The observed price range in the market spans from 5 to 100 USD, a wide variance that reflects differences in material quality, design complexity, and included features. A chair priced at the lower end of this spectrum is likely to be a simple plastic unit with minimal structural reinforcement, whereas a unit at the higher end may feature a full steel frame, advanced powder coating, and ergonomic armrests.

Minimum Order Quantity (MOQ) is a significant cost driver. The data indicates an MOQ range of 10 to 1000 pieces. Some suppliers may require an MOQ of 1000 pieces for custom models, while others might accept orders as low as 10 units. This variability directly impacts the unit price; higher volumes typically yield lower per-unit costs due to economies of scale. Buyers must also consider the "Sample" availability. While samples are available, the cost and lead time for these samples should be factored into the initial procurement budget. Quality Control and Long-Term Procurement

Ensuring long-term value requires a robust quality control (QC) strategy. The "Surface Treatment: Powder Coating" is a key quality indicator, as it protects the steel frame from corrosion. Buyers should request evidence of the coating thickness and adhesion tests to ensure the finish will not peel or chip over time. The "Load Capacity: 120kgs" is a specific performance metric that must be validated through third-party testing, especially for public venues where safety is paramount.
